In 2010, Netflix entered the international market by expanding into Canada. [6] In 2011, Netflix began to expand more. From September 5 to September 12, 2011, Netflix began rolling out its services to over 40 countries in the Latin America and Caribbean regions. [7] Netflix began its expansion into Europe in 2012.
